Revisiting auditory-triggered reality checks in lucid dream induction: A sleep laboratory study

University Library Heidelberg March 10, 2026 Xinlin Wang, Johanna Heitmann, Lorenzo de Neri et al.

Lucid dreaming is a state where dreamers know they are dreaming and may control dream content. It offers a model for studying cognition during sleep and potential therapeutic uses, but reliable induction methods remain under investigation. This study combined Tholey's critical reflection technique with an acoustic cue to induce lucid dreams. Participants completed a two-day training on a reality-check task paired with the cue, then spent a night in the lab where the same cue was played during REM sleep. Of 15 participants, one reported a lucid dream meeting strict criteria. Future research should refine the experimental design.
